In 2008, Sapient has significantly increased the number of developers and architects who are ATG certified and the company already has an impressive global team of technology implementation experts in place who are trained and experienced with ATG's suite of e-commerce software products. The ATG Commerce Suite is a set of flexible, component-based e-commerce software applications that enable merchants to personalize the online buying experience for their customers, making it easy for them to find desired products, comparison shop, register for gifts, pre-order products, redeem coupons and execute many other useful features.
